B.P.R.D. The Devil You Know Omnibus isn't just a collection of comic narratives; it's a relentless plunge into the shadows of the supernatural and the anguished cries of humanity that echo beneath the weight of monstrous legacies. Crafted by the visionary minds of Mike Mignola and Scott Allie, this tome serves as a testament to the boundless depth of storytelling within the Hellboy universe, thrusting us into a maelstrom of horror, heroism, and the unimaginable.
The B.P.R.D. - Bureau for Paranormal Research and Defense - stands not merely as a fictional agency but as a meta-commentary on our collective struggle against the dark forces that threaten to unravel our very sanity. In this anthology, the characters wrestle with their own demons, reflecting the tumultuous journey within us all. Readers encounter the psychologically complex Liz Sherman, who battles her own fire-wielding abilities, and the undeniable force of Hellboy, whose legacy looms large over every page. The narrative is laced with a series of interconnected crises that shatter the barriers between good and evil, revealing that the greatest threat often comes from within.
As you dive into the artful chaos spun by Mignola's pen, the visuals undulate with a haunting beauty, plunging you into an eerie atmosphere rife with Gothic architecture and creatures born from the nightmares of our darkest fears. The illustrations explode off the page, invoking raw emotions, from heart-pounding terror to moments of unexpected tenderness. Each frame pulses with life, drawing you deeper into a world that feels both alien and hauntingly familiar.
